On Jul 8, 2009, at 1:49 AM, Kendall Bennett wrote:

> I have noticed what looks to be a bug in Qt Creator 1.2. It seems  
> that it does not like inline functions in class declarations, and is  
> highlighting the code with an squiggly underline as though there is  
> something wrong with it. Check the attached screen shot. Any idea  
> what would cause this?

It's not a bug, it's just a warning message for the extra semicolon at  
the end of the function definition. You should get a tooltip with the  
warning's description if you hover with the mouse the function  
definition.
